take the browser plunge 06/18/2004 03:56 PM

"It's time to tell our users, our clients, our associates, our families, and our friends to abandon Internet Explorer". Mozilla Firefox 0.9 and Thunderbird 0.7 are out, and today is a great day to make the switch from Internet Explorer and O utlook Express once and for all. Microsoft's own Set Program Access and Defaults feature makes it easy to set everything to use Firefox/Thunderbird and hide IE/OE completely.

BYOB: Build Your Own Browser, Part 2


BYOB: Build Your Own Browser, Part 2 05/30/2004 11:42 PM
The wait is over and the second installment of "Build Your Own Browser" (BYOB) is finally here. The first installment focused on using Interface Builder to build a simple browser without using any code. The browser was functional but lacked many of the features that are available in modern web browsers. The next two installments will make our browser more powerful by using some of the more advanced aspects of WebKit...
